Ingredients
Scale
- 1 round (5.2 oz / 150 g) Boursin cheese (Garlic & Fine Herbs or Cranberry & Pepper)
- 2 tablespoons honey (or hot honey for a spicy twist)
- 3 tablespoons shelled pistachios, chopped
- 1 tablespoon fresh herbs (thyme, parsley, or rosemary), finely chopped
- Crackers, crostini, or baguette slices for serving
- Optional Additions:
- 2 tablespoons dried cranberries or pomegranate seeds
- A sprinkle of black pepper or chili flakes
- Drizzle of balsamic glaze for depth
Instructions
- Place the Cheese: Unwrap Boursin and place it on a serving board or platter. Optionally reshape it into a round mound for presentation.
- Add the Toppings: Sprinkle chopped pistachios over the top. Drizzle with honey and add a few sprigs of fresh herbs. For a festive touch, scatter cranberries or pomegranate seeds.
- Serve and Enjoy: Surround the cheese with crackers, crostini, or baguette slices. For a complete grazing board, add fruits, nuts, or cured meats.
Notes
- Serve Boursin at room temperature for the creamiest texture.
- Avoid overloading toppings — keep the look elegant and balanced.
- For a warm variation, bake Boursin at 325°F (160°C) for 5–7 minutes for a melted dip.
- Make ahead up to 24 hours and refrigerate until ready to serve.
